FERMA provides a range of resources to support candidates preparing for the rimap® certification exam and to guide those who wish to deepen their knowledge beyond the exam requirements.
Three reference books, published in collaboration with Emerald Publishing, compile key content from the rimap® Body of Knowledge:
- Essentials and Assessment of Risk Management – covering Blocks 1 & 2
- Risk Treatment – covering Blocks 3 & 4
- Risk Measurement and Monitoring – covering Blocks 5 & 6 (not required for the exam but valuable for advanced workshop or those looking to expand their expertise)
The books are available for purchase on Amazon and through Emerald Publishing. Candidates who enroll in the rimap® certification programme will receive a 30% discount code to use on the Emerald platform.
In addition, four sets of lecture notes, developed by FERMA’s team of risk experts, remain accessible via the rimap® platform upon enrolment. These notes support study for the first four blocks of the Body of Knowledge and are the core materials for exam preparation.

The FERMA rimap® Preparatory Course is a six-day course aimed at equipping participants to prepare for FERMA rimap® Risk Management certification. Given the demanding nature of balancing work and other obligations, mastering exam preparation can be quite the task. This Preparatory Course steps in to provide the necessary guidance and support to excel!
The FERMA rimap® Preparatory Course focuses on the key areas in the Body of Knowledge. It helps participants get ready for the exam by giving them specific preparation, useful tips, and mock exams.
